Creamy Avocado Dressing

1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il
juice from 1 lime
1 large clove garlic, cut into 2-3 pieces
1/2 jalapeno pepper, de-veined, seeded, and cut into 2-3 pieces
(or you can go the lazy route and throw in 2-3 dashes of tabasco sauce....works just as well)
1/2 cup Vegenaise (purchase from any health food store)
1 teaspoon Worchestershire sauce or Braggs liquid aminos
1/2 cup cilantro
1/2 avocado
salt to taste (about 1/2 tsp)
1 Tablespoon water


Combine all ingredients in a food processor.  Check for seasoning.  If you want a thinner consistency, add a little more water (I added an extra tablespoon).  Store in refrigerator.
